What is the total number of electron-donating methyl groups directly attached to the positively charged central carbon atom in a tertiary butyl carbocation ($(CH_3)_3C^+$), maximizing its $+I$ stabilization?

Answer: 3

💡 Solution & Explanation

In a tertiary butyl carbocation, the central $sp^2$ hybridized carbon bearing the positive charge is directly bonded to exactly 3 methyl groups, all of which exert a $+I$ effect to heavily stabilize the ion.
